Thanks to the pandemic, we have been used to staying at home longer than we expected. Many people have found themselves gaining much weight because they might lay down on the sofa all day long. To help you to be healthy and productive at home, we want to share 5 useful tips.
Cultivate your hobby
We all have our own hobbies, but we usually can’t find enough time to do those things due to busy work schedules. Now it is the best time to further explore our potentials. No matter if you like to paint or play a musical instrument, you can find millions of free tutorials online to teach yourself.
Keep a workout schedule
Stop using the excuses of no gyms. If you want to exercise, you only need a yoga mat. The biggest downside of staying at home is that we don’t get enough exercise, so we have to intentionally execute our workout plans. It is true that you might not be able to do some exercises that you used to do in the gym, but you can still find numerous feasible exercises to keep you energetic and productive at home.
Work on home improvement projects
If you are really not a big fan of doing indoor exercises, you can look into DIY home projects, which might be fun to many people. For example, you can easily apply styrofoam ceiling tiles to cover your popcorn ceilings and install new vinyl floorings for your lovely home. For bigger home projects like window replacements, you can take advantage of your spare time to talk to different local window installers to get a better price.
Learn new skills
Learning new skills or knowledge is a little different from exploring your hobbies. It is more related to your career. For example, you can expand your knowledge by learning data analysis or even coding or programming. Now we have entered the big data era, you can improve your competitive advantage by equipping yourself with cutting edge skills. Not to mention that those knowledge might help you get a higher salary or even land a new job from a prominent IT company.
Get some side income
Money can always be the source of stress. Why not take advantage of the free time to get some extra income to support your family? It is true that you can’t expect too much return in the beginning, but if you can be persistent, you will be able to build up your own brand. For example, you can start your own YouTube Channel, work on SEO ranking as well as write blog posts. In the long run, you will get more audience so that you can earn passive income by participating in affiliate marketing programs.
